The book explores the decline of Roman law and its subsequent revival across France, England, and Germany, as presented through a series of lectures by esteemed scholar Sir Paul Vinogradoff. It delves into the historical context and significance of these legal transformations, providing insights into the evolution of legal systems in Europe. The concise format of 136 pages offers a focused examination of the subject, making complex legal history accessible to readers.
